When using the Blackmagic Cinema Camera is it possible to zoom in to check critical focus? For example, when using a DSLR, you can just hit the plus button and zoom in like 5 to 6 times.

There is focus peaking so you can determine the edges of your subjects and see what is in focus.

The LCD is also considerably larger than those of most DSLRs and, at least to my eyes, gives a clearer picture of what you're shooting.

Yes. You can double tap the screen to zoom in for critical focus but only in the center.

If you double tap the LCD screen, it will zoom in to check focus. There's only one level of zoom, but used in conjunction with the focus peaking, it's been very reliable for us.
